First Alarm Dark Roast is crafted for bold strength — deep, rich flavor with low acidity, full body, and a smooth, lingering finish. Built for those who need reliable power in every cup, this roast excels in methods that highlight its intensity and smoothness.

Drip / Pour-Over (Recommended for daily drinking)

  • Ratio: 1:15–1:16
    (20–22 g coffee → 12 oz water)
  • Grind: Medium-Coarse
  • Water Temp: 195–200°F
  • Result: Bold, rich cup with deep chocolate notes and a clean, powerful finish.

🫖 French Press

  • Ratio: 1:14–1:15
  • Grind: Coarse
  • Steep Time: 4–5 minutes
  • Result: Full-bodied and robust with enhanced sweetness and velvety mouthfeel.

❄️ Cold Brew

  • Ratio: 1:10–1:12
  • Grind: Extra-Coarse
  • Brew Time: 14–18 hours (refrigerated)
  • Result: Smooth, low-acid cup with intense flavor and natural sweetness.

Espresso & Moka Pot

  • Dose: 18–20 g in / 36–40 g out
  • Grind: Fine
  • Shot Time: 25–30 seconds
  • Result: Rich, bold espresso with dark chocolate notes and excellent crema for straight shots or milk drinks.

Final Notes
Dark roasts are bold and forgiving — they shine when brewed a little stronger. Start by adjusting grind size for taste, then tweak ratio if needed. Best enjoyed black or with a splash of milk.

Grind Guide

Not sure which grind to pick? Match it to how you brew. Whole bean gives you the most control — grind fresh right before you brew.

Fine
Coarse
Whole Bean
Grind Your Own

Best if you have a grinder. Maximum freshness and full control over every brew. Grind only what you need, when you need it.

Texture: Unground beans
Espresso
Espresso · Moka Pot

Very fine and powdery. Built for high-pressure machines and strong, concentrated shots.

Texture: Powdered sugar
Fine
Pour-Over · Aeropress

Quick brew methods. Fast extraction and bold flavor — ideal for short brew times.

Texture: Table salt
Drip
Auto Drip Makers

The everyday all-rounder. Balanced extraction for standard coffee makers — Mr. Coffee, Breville, and the like.

Texture: Coarse sand
Press
French Press

Slightly coarser than drip to avoid grittiness and improve plunge resistance. Made specifically for French Press.

Texture: Rough sand
Coarse
Cold Brew · French Press

Chunky, sea-salt texture. Prevents over-extraction during long steeps — the right call for cold brew.

Texture: Sea salt
